The 2UUL DA84 CVT Polishing Pen is a rechargeable, variable-speed grinder and polishing pen designed for professional and hobbyist electronics repair. Its pen-like design allows for high-precision work on delicate components like IC chips, screens, and motherboards, especially for mobile devices. 

Key features

  • Continuously Variable Transmission (CVT): This advanced technology allows for stepless speed control, so you can precisely adjust the rotational speed for different tasks.

  • High rotational speed: With a maximum speed of up to 18,000 RPM, it can handle tough grinding and polishing jobs efficiently.

  • Cordless and rechargeable: A built-in, rechargeable battery provides portability and freedom of movement for on-the-go repairs, eliminating the hassle of cords.

  • Ergonomic design: The pen's lightweight and comfortable grip minimizes hand fatigue during prolonged use, which is ideal for intricate and detailed work.

  • Multiple attachments: The tool comes with a variety of interchangeable attachments, such as grinding bits, drill bits, and polishing heads, to handle different applications.

  • Versatile applications: While specialized for phone repair, its precision makes it suitable for other tasks like jewelry making, model building, and engraving on various materials, including plastic, glass, and metal. 

Typical use cases

The

2UUL DA84

is primarily used by technicians for mobile phone maintenance and repair, including:

  • IC chip polishing and grinding: Precisely removing or correcting IC chips and other integrated circuits on motherboards.

  • Frame and screen correction: Polishing and smoothing a device's frame or screen, especially after repairs.

  • Disassembly and component removal: Drilling or grinding away stubborn adhesives or broken glass.

  • Removing stripped screws: With a fine grinding tip, a technician can carefully carve a new slot into a stripped screw head to allow for removal.
